Cy-Fair High School

Cy-Fair High School is a secondary school located in Cypress, which is an unincorporated place in Harris County, Texas, near Houston. The school, located along U.S. Highway 290, is part of the Cypress-Fairbanks Independent School District. In 2011, the school was rated "recognized" by the Texas Education Agency.

Weiser Air Park

Weiser Air Park is a privately owned, public-use airport located on the Northwest Freeway in Cypress, an unincorporated area of Harris County, Texas, United States. The airport is 11 nautical miles (20 km) northwest of the central business district of Houston Although most U.S. airports use the same three-letter location identifier for the FAA and IATA, Weiser Air Park is assigned EYQ by the FAA but has no designation from the IATA.

Cypress, Texas

Cypress (sometimes combined as Cy-Fair for Cypress-Fairbanks, the latter now incorporated as a neighborhood of Houston) is an unincorporated area of Harris County, Texas, United States located completely inside the extraterritorial jurisdiction of the City of Houston. The Cypress area is located along U.S. Highway 290 (Northwest Freeway) approximately twenty-five miles (40 km) northwest of Downtown Houston.

Richard E. Berry Educational Support Center

The Richard E. Berry Educational Support Center is a multi-purpose sports complex located in Cypress, Texas. It was completed in March 2006 and consists of five separate facilities: an arena, stadium, theater, conference center and food production center. It was named after former Cy-Fair ISD superintendent Richard E. Berry.

KYND

KYND is a brokered time radio station in the Houston, Texas metropolitan area. KYND is owned by Pro Broadcasting, Inc. The station is leased and currently airs an English language service from China Radio International.
